Strategic Font Pairing for Maximum Impact
While Auro Rumpthut is powerful as a display font, it shines brightest when paired correctly. In editorial design and web design, pairing a creative font with a neutral counterpart is a proven strategy. For our landing page headers, I paired Auro Rumpthut with a clean, geometric sans-serif font for the body copy. This combination allowed the script to grab attention while the sans-serif provided the necessary structure for reading longer paragraphs.
This pairing principle applies to almost every asset we create. On social media posts, the script acts as the emotional anchor, while the supporting typography handles the logistical details. Whether designing packaging design concepts or branded templates for clients, this duality creates a sophisticated look that feels both curated and accessible. It avoids the common pitfall of overusing script fonts, which can make a design look messy or unprofessional if applied to large blocks of text.
